This study investigates the urea-induced structural transitions of bovine serum albumin (BSA) in solution using size-exclusion chromatography coupled with small-angle X-ray scattering (SEC-SAXS). BSA samples treated with 0 to 8 M urea were subjected to SEC to isolate monomeric species, enabling the acquisition of high-quality SAXS data and ab initio 3D modeling using GASBOR. Key structural parameters-including the radius of gyration (Rg), maximum dimension (Dmax), and pair distance distribution function P(r)─were derived from the scattering profiles. Three major conformational states were identified: a compact globular form (0-3 M urea), a partially unfolded intermediate (4 M urea), and a highly disordered conformation (5-8 M urea). These transitions were corroborated by Kratky analysis and structural modeling. At higher urea concentrations, GASBOR yielded representative average structures, while the ensemble optimization method (EOM) revealed conformational heterogeneity, reflecting increased structural flexibility. Overall, SEC-SAXS enabled detailed characterization of BSA unfolding and provided insights into protein dynamics and stability under denaturing conditions.
